This paper is a component of the wider research study into bisexuals and their online tasks From a far more than representational approach, Van Doorn ( 2011 ) draws near spaces being virtual areas for which actualisation associated with the digital takes place. He discovers motivation in conversations on the ‘virtual’ and ‘actual’ . Van Doorn contends that digital areas can subscribe to actualisation of this digital through text, images, and videos. As a result, he views spaces that are virtual performative areas by which digital and tangible elements get together. (more…)
